Output 34b103059dcbc787c2660c6a4ad9f875390172de532fa868dca295ab281c6c9a:0

value
466792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 231f5bb3a083ae4e574ecc3cdd345d738d29e868 OP_EQUAL
address
34tj94gy3KNhjAyuBdCq7tTxFg5WyZNGxT
transaction
34b103059dcbc787c2660c6a4ad9f875390172de532fa868dca295ab281c6c9a